Internacional and Fluminense return to the field this Wednesday night (20), at 8:30 pm, at Sesc Campestre, for the second round of the Brasileirão Feminino. Colorado is looking for its first victory, while Flu wants to continue with 100% success in the competition.

Women’s Brazilian Statistics

In the debut of the Brasileirão Feminino, Inter drew 1-1 with América-MG, away from home, while Fluminense beat Atlético-MG 3-0, at home.

So far, six teams have won the national competition, with Corinthians, in addition to the current champion, being the one that has lifted the most cups: five times (2018, 2020, 2021, 2022 and 2023). Next, Ferroviária, one of the powerhouses of women’s football, with two cups (2014 and 2019). In third place, with one titles, are Rio Preto (2015), Centro Olímpico (2013), Flamengo (2016) and Santos (2017).
